Dr. Gunn Selected for Prestigious Porter Prize

Dr. Kathryn Gunn has been selected by the American Society of Cell Biology (ASCB) to receive the Porter Prize for Postdoctoral Research Excellence! The award, which honors the innovative spirit of one of ASCB’s founders, Dr. Keith Porter, recognizes novel and creative contributions to the advancement of science.

The award recognizes Dr. Gunn’s discovery of quaternary structure regulation of lipoprotein lipase during vesicle storage. The award will be given at the 2023 ASCB conference in Boston. Dr. Gunn will also give a presentation at the conference on her recent work entitled “Filamentation of Lipoprotein Lipase in Secretory Vesicles.”
